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1383628 8378 339109866 27 920
8217770 19332831 6561
8217770 19332831 6561
0316421 0084132 9470747
All about undefined
Interested in learning more?
8217770 19332831 6561
0316421 0084132 9470747
See more
881870509 50831
483224 466 4957395 39311500
See more
75488 211392
661165 2734808 460161
See more